Amsterdam: Heavy snowfall has disrupted air, road and rail travel in France and the Netherlands, with hundreds of flights cancelled in the countries’ capitals, while trains around Amsterdam came to a standstill and bus services in Paris were suspended.

Amsterdam Schiphol airport, one of Europe’s busiest hubs, cancelled about 700 flights on Monday as the airport closed to incoming traffic until 1200 GMT (11pm AEDT) due to the snow, a spokesperson said. During that time, planes were diverted to other airports.

“There are long lines here,” a traveller stranded at Schiphol told Dutch media outlet AD. “There’s not too much clarity on what is actually going to happen.”

Meanwhile, France’s civil aviation authority asked carriers to reduce take-offs and landings by 15 per cent, or roughly 30 flights, at Paris-Charles de Gaulle, and 40 flights at Paris-Orly until the evening, according to Aeroports de Paris.

1000km of traffic jams in Paris

French Transport Minister Philippe Tabarot urged travellers to check if their flight was operating before leaving home, and to use public transport to reach the airport.

He also ordered speed restrictions of 80km/h on roads across the Ile-de-France region that surrounds Paris. State-owned RATP, which operates Paris’ public transportation, said it cancelled dozens of bus lines. Underground and suburban trains were operating normally.
